Abstract

A passive sonar bearing tracker having spaced arrays wherein the target bing is a function of the electrical phase angle of the signal between the arrays. Confidence in the bearing estimate is increased in spite of the relatively narrow bandwidth of the signal and a low signal-to-noise ratio by sequentially bandpass frequency filtering each very narrow component of the narrowband signal, computing the phase difference between respective filter pairs, accumulating the phase differences over a selected time period and displaying the phase difference calibrated as a bearing. In a second embodiment the individual differences are weighed according to the magnitude of the frequency signal at the associated very narrow band.
